This paper continues the design considerations of a novel type of passive filter called hybrid LC filter (HLCF). The filter is aimed at significant reduction in high-frequency differential mode (DM) and common mode (CM) currents in speed-controlled ac drives. A model of the HLCF is presented. Based on the model, a transfer function of the HLCF is found. The HLCF behavior is analyzed in frequency domain. A method for HLCF frequency-domain behavior estimation with asymptotes is proposed. A comparison of the measured, simulated, and calculated results in frequency domain is presented.
